The webcast will review some of the fundamentals of the conditioning and dewatering process and their implications for full-scale dewatering practice, the discussion will include: 

  1. Factors affecting polymer conditioning – role of shear and mixing 

  1. Water fractions and their relationship to dewatering and mechanical dewatering (what is removed in dewatering) 

  1. Floc characteristics and their impacts on dewatering (role of protein and cations) 

  2. Impact of processes on dewatering (THP, bioP, aerobic digestion, anaerobic digestion)
